  The main methods for ensuring the cleanliness of a liquid filling machine are as follows:

  First, keep the pipelines of the liquid filling machine clean. Particular attention should be paid to all pipelines, especially those that come into indirect or direct contact with materials, which must be kept clean. How can this be achieved? Generally, it is only necessary to follow the points below. First, brush-clean them weekly, flush them with water daily, and sterilize them each time. Second, ensure that the filling machine is clean, and repeatedly brush-clean and sterilize the material tank to ensure that the parts in contact with materials are free of deposits and miscellaneous bacteria.

  Second, during production, ensure the biological stability and sterilization of bottled beverages. The method is to strictly control the sterilization time and temperature to ensure effective results. At the same time, avoid excessively long sterilization times or excessively high temperatures to reduce beverage oxidation. Therefore, the best practice is to cool the product as soon as possible after sterilization, preferably to no more than 35℃. Low-temperature filling is a basic requirement for beverage filling because beverages are generally less likely to foam in a low-temperature environment, which is beneficial for filling.

  Before each operation of the liquid filling machine, be sure to use cold water at 0~1℃ to further reduce the temperature of the filling machine tank and conveying pipelines. If the filling temperature exceeds 4℃, the temperature should be reduced before filling. Make full use of the insulated tank or constant-temperature filling function so that the material can remain at a constant temperature throughout the specified filling operation time, thereby preventing unstable operation of the liquid filling machine caused by excessive temperature fluctuations. In addition, repeatedly ensure that the filling equipment is isolated from other equipment. In particular, cross-contamination between the lubrication and filling material sections of the liquid filling machine must be prevented. It is also important not to overlook that the conveyor belt should be lubricated with soapy water or lubricating oil.
